AI Appraisal Report

Upon visual examination of the provided image, I assess this automotive component, likely a Volvo mud flap, to be in used but functional condition. The visible dirt, dust, and minor scuffs are consistent with typical road use. Authenticity, based solely on the clear "VOLVO" embossed branding, appears strong. However, without inspecting the reverse side for part numbers or manufacturing stamps, full authentication is limited. Market conditions for used mud flaps are generally low, as they are utility items prone to wear and tear. New, aftermarket mud flaps can be purchased relatively inexpensively, while genuine OEM replacements would be more costly. The demand for a used, single mud flap for an unspecified Volvo model is inherently niche. Rarity is not a factor here; mud flaps are mass-produced. The primary factors impacting value are its used condition and the availability of new alternatives. The dirt accumulation significantly detracts from its perceived value, though it's easily cleaned. To definitively verify authenticity and model compatibility, I would require an in-person examination to check for part numbers, material consistency, and overall structural integrity. Provenance documentation, such as a vehicle's VIN or service records, would also aid in confirming original fitment. Without these, the appraisal is based purely on its visual characteristics as a generic used Volvo mud flap.
